CONCEPT


Meaning of CONCEPT in English

/ ˈkɒnsept; NAmE ˈkɑːn-/ noun

concept (of sth) | concept (that ... ) an idea or a principle that is connected with sth abstract :

the concept of social class

concepts such as 'civilization' and 'government'

He can't grasp the basic concepts of mathematics.

the concept that everyone should have equality of opportunity

••

WORD ORIGIN

mid 16th cent. (in the sense thought, imagination ): from Latin conceptum something conceived, from Latin concept- conceived, from concipere , from com- together + capere take
